Reminder: Merry weakened him first by stabbing him behind the knee with his blade

The book explains it more:
The sword(really a dagger) that Merry had was found in the Barrow Downs(not shown in the films) and it was crafted in Westernesse centuries before specifically to fight evil. When he stabbed the WK, it shattered the magic shield he had allowing Eowyn to finish him off.

PJ never put any of this into the trilogy even with the extended edition. No scenes were ever shot featuring that. So we can just assume he weakened the WK with a loophole about "No men being able to kill him" considering both weren't men.

Tolkien spent decades coming up with the world -its peoples, history, languages, and mythology- before he wrote LOTR. World-building was his personal hobby. He was also a knowledgable linguist and was able to give the elements of his stories convincing and authentic-sounding names that fit into the cultural frameworks that he had constructed.

Writing actual novels was kinda like an afterthought for Tolkien, whereas most other fantasy authors have it as their primary goal.

The Witch-king, taunting Eärnur, fled the battlefield. When Eärnur attempted to follow, Glorfindel stopped him with a warning that would become prophetic in the future:

"Do not pursue him! He will not return to these lands. Far off yet is his doom, and not by the hand of man shall he fall."
